Position Summary

The Junior UX Designer is an entry-level role designed for individuals starting their careers in UX design. The positions contributes to the design and development of user experiences for web and native applications, under the guidance of more experienced designers and developers. This role requires a basic understanding of design principles and a willingness to learn both UX design and front-end development. The Associate UX Designer works closely with senior designers, product managers, and developers to create wireframes, prototypes, and visual designs that meet user needs and business objectives.

Job Responsibilities/Essential Duties

  • Serve as an individual contributor on a single team, focusing on projects of lower complexity.
  • Collaborate with peers, software teams, digital marketing, and senior designers, contributing to the overall team effort by executing tasks under supervision.
  • Participate in brainstorming sessions, design discussions, and UX reviews to foster learning and teamwork.
  • Assist in executing project tasks such as creating wireframes, low-fidelity prototypes, and visual design elements.
  • Support the design team with front-end development aspects (e.g., HTML, CSS, JavaScript), gradually building coding.
  • Work on improving the user experience of both native and web-based applications while adhering to design system guidelines.
  • Collaborate closely with development teams to ensure smooth handoff from design to development, adhering to SCRUM processes.
  • Utilize design systems, style guides, and prototyping tools like Figma to ensure consistency and quality across designs.
  • Apply a creative use of color, typography, and iconography within established design systems, ensuring designs meet business objectives and user needs.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including developers, product managers, and marketing, to ensure designs meet both user and business needs.
  • Participate in SCRUM ceremonies and contribute to team discussions on design improvements and project status.
  • Contribute to design reviews and ensure that your work aligns with team goals, project timelines, and development standards.
  • Handle other duties as assigned to meet evolving organizational needs.

Required Skills And Abilities

  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.
  • Basic understanding of design principles, user research, wire-framing, and front-end development (HTML, CSS, JavaScript, Figma).
  • Ability to work in a collaborative team environment and also self-manage workload
  • Build positive relationships across departments
  • Basic problem-solving skills, applying creative solutions to UX challenges with support from the team.
  • Organ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age tasks efficiently with supervision.
  • Enthusiasm for learning new tools, processes, and techniques in both design and front-end development.

Education And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in UX design, human-computer interaction, or a related field, or completion of a relevant bootcamp/certification program.
  • 0-2 years of experience in UX design or front-end development. No prior professional experience is required.
